WebCountess Mountbatten House (CMH) is a palliative care service for the region, providing care, comfort and compassionate support to people with life-limiting illnesses and their families. It serves the communities of Southampton and large parts of Hampshire including Eastleigh, Romsey, Winchester and the surrounding areas.
